NASTF releases SDRM Tutorial | | LEESBURG, Va. – The National Automotive Service Task Force (NASTF) has announced a new
tutorial for the Secure Data Release Module (SDRM), which provides online directions for service repair facilities
and locksmiths wishing to become registered and thus be eligible to receive vehicle security information through
the SDRM system. | | 11/18/2008 11:00:00 PM |

ABRA opens Denver-area repair center | | MINNEAPOLIS — ABRA Auto Body & Glass, a Minneapolis-based damaged vehicle
repair company, opened its 16th repair center in Colorado. Located at 4201 East Louisiana Avenue in the Cherry
Creek area of Denver, this is ABRA's 95th repair center in 11 states. | | 11/17/2008 11:00:00 PM |
